Card Details
BONUS OFFER
Earn a one-time $250 cash bonus once you spend $500 on purchases within the first 3 months from account opening
REWARDS INFO
Earn unlimited 3% cash back on dining and entertainment, 2% at grocery stores (excluding superstores like Walmart® and Target®) and 1% on all other purchases.
ANNUAL FEE
$0
PURCHASE APR
0% intro APR for 15 months; 15.49% - 25.49% variable APR after that
TRANSFER INFO
15.49% - 25.49% variable APR; No Transfer Fee
No Foreign Transaction Fees

The original post says:
TRANSFER INFO
15.49% - 25.49% variable APR; No Transfer Fee

Disclosures for a card say:
Transaction Fees
TransferTransaction Fee:3% of the amount of each transferred balance that posts to your account at a promotional APR that we may offer you.

None for balances transferred at the Transfer APR.

So, to me it looks like Transfer fee is 3%, No Transfer Fee.

Can someone confirm?
